币圈在线

您现在的位置是:首页 > 比特币 > 正文

比特币

比特币同步更新 比特币区块同步解决

2024-04-09 23:24:01比特币109
比特币是一种去中心化的数字货币,其特点是无需第三方机构的支持,用户可以直接进行交易和转账。然而,随着比特币的流行,一个问题逐渐凸显出来,那就是比特币区块的同步更新问题。比特币的交易记录保存在一个被称为“区

比特币同步更新 比特币区块同步解决

比特币是一种去中心化的数字货币,其特点是无需第三方机构的支持,用户可以直接进行交易和转账。然而,随着比特币的流行,一个问题逐渐凸显出来,那就是比特币区块的同步更新问题。

比特币的交易记录保存在一个被称为“区块链”的公共账本中。这个区块链是由一系列的区块组成的,每个区块都包含了一定数量的交易记录。新的交易发生时,这些交易将被打包成一个新的区块,然后添加到区块链的末尾。每个区块都有一个唯一的标识符,称为“区块哈希”,这个标识符是由区块中的数据计算出来的。

然而,由于比特币网络中的节点数量庞大,网络的传输速度有限,导致比特币区块的同步更新成为一个相对较慢的过程。当一个新的区块被创建时,它需要被传播到整个网络中的节点,然后每个节点都需要验证这个区块的有效性,最后才能将其添加到自己的区块链中。这个过程需要一定的时间,尤其是在网络拥堵或者攻击的情况下。

为了解决比特币区块的同步更新问题,比特币网络采用了一种被称为“工作量证明”的机制。简单来说,工作量证明就是要求节点通过解决一个数学难题来证明自己的工作量,并获得相应的奖励。这个数学难题通常是一个哈希碰撞问题,即找到一个特定的输入,使得它的哈希值满足一定的条件。只有当一个节点解决了这个难题,其他节点才会接受它所提供的区块。

通过工作量证明机制,比特币网络保证了区块的同步更新。因为只有解决了难题的节点才能添加新的区块,而其他节点会按照比特币协议的规定接受这个区块,从而保持整个网络的一致性。同时,工作量证明机制还能防止恶意节点对网络的攻击,因为攻击者需要掌握超过50%的算力才能成功攻击网络,这几乎是不可能的。

然而,虽然工作量证明机制解决了比特币区块同步更新的问题,但它也带来了一些新的挑战。由于解决难题需要大量的计算资源,所以参与比特币挖矿的成本非常高昂。这使得挖矿变得越来越集中化,只有少数大型矿场能够承担得起这样的成本,而普通用户很难参与其中。这也导致了比特币网络的安全性受到了一定的威胁,因为如果有一个组织掌握了超过50%的算力,它就能够对网络进行攻击。

为了解决这个问题,一些新的数字货币项目开始尝试采用其他的共识机制,例如权益证明、股份证明等。这些共识机制不依赖于计算资源的消耗,而是根据用户持有的货币数量或者股份数量来决定他们对网络的影响力。这样一来,普通用户也能够参与到网络的维护中来,从而增加了网络的安全性和去中心化程度。

总之,比特币区块的同步更新是一个需要解决的重要问题。通过工作量证明机制,比特币网络保证了区块的同步更新和整个网络的一致性。然而,工作量证明机制也带来了一些挑战,例如挖矿的集中化和网络的安全性问题。为了解决这些问题,新的数字货币项目开始尝试其他的共识机制。这些共识机制能够增加网络的安全性和去中心化程度,从而为未来的数字货币发展提供更好的解决方案。